    Property-Specific Energy Simulation

    Optimize performance with custom energy modeling that transforms your roof's reality—daylight duration, tilt, azimuth, shading, module temperature, and local weather—into a detailed production forecast. We blend satellite irradiance, ground-level sensor data, and historic CHWK climate normals to calculate yield across seasons. Our microclimate analysis factors in valley fog, orographic rainfall, and temperature swings that impact cell efficiency and inverter clipping. A thorough shading assessment maps hourly losses from trees, dormers, and nearby structures using LiDAR and horizon profiles. We model temperature coefficients, snow persistence, soiling rates, and DC/AC ratios to refine system sizing and energy confidence intervals. You'll see bankable outputs: monthly kWh projections, performance tolerance bands, degradation curves, and financial impacts, so you can decide with evidence—not guesses.

    Optimal Panel Placement

    Though each roof differs, ideal panel placement follows hard data: we orient arrays to boost annual kWh/kW by coordinating azimuth, tilt, row spacing, and shading buffers confirmed through LiDAR and horizon scans. We simulate hourly sun paths, then employ azimuth optimization to capture your peak production window—true south when possible, or strategic east/west splits to flatten peaks. We assess roof shading from trees, chimneys, and ridges, then situate modules to reduce mismatch losses and support effective MLPE operation.

    We adjust tilt for Chilliwack's geographic latitude, snow clearance, and wind loading, and set row spacing to avoid back-row shading in winter. On ground mounts, we implement backtracking profiles; on roofs, we focus on keep-outs for service pathways and code clearances. The result: greater yield, lower LCOE.

    High-Quality Panel Systems and Proven Installation Protocols

    As long-term performance starts with intelligent component selections, prioritize Tier 1, UL/CSA-certified modules with high efficiency (20–23%+), minimal annual degradation rates (≤0.5%/yr), and solid 25–30 year performance warranties. You'll maximize output and safeguard ROI with panel durability validated through IEC 61215/61730 testing and stringent manufacturing standards that validate cell quality, lamination integrity, and PID resistance.

    Combine premium modules with proven installation practices. Insist on racking engineered to CSA A370/ASCE 7 wind and snow loads, corrosion-resistant fasteners, and flashed, torque-specified penetrations that maintain your roof warranty. Require NEC/CEC-compliant wiring, AFCI/rapid shutdown, and properly sized conductors to limit voltage drop. Choose inverters with ≥97% CEC efficiency and documented MTBF data. Additionally, require commissioning reports: IV-curve traces, insulation resistance, thermal imaging, and production baselines to validate performance on day one.

    Preventive Maintenance Planning

    Actively maintain performance with a preventative maintenance schedule that's customized to Chilliwack's climate, site conditions, and equipment mix. We schedule tasks to weather patterns: spring and fall seasonal inspections examine string voltage, IV curves, thermal signatures, and racking torque. You'll decrease degradation by identifying soiling, shading growth, and connector resistance before they cost yield.

    With each visit, we perform module cleaning as required, assess insulation resistance, upgrade inverter firmware, and document KPIs against baseline standards. On a quarterly basis, we complete filter replacement on inverters and combiner cooling, flush drains, and inspect conduit seals to eliminate moisture ingress. Annually, we calibrate monitoring sensors, secure terminations to spec, and verify ground continuity. The result: increased uptime, steady kWh/kW, and predictable O&M costs matched with your asset's production goals.

    Can Solar Be Integrated With Existing Backup Generators?

    Absolutely—solar integration with your existing backup generators is possible. You'll need generator compatibility verification, a properly sized transfer switch, and a hybrid inverter that supports AC-coupling. We examine generator frequency stability, automatic start/stop signaling, and load prioritization to avoid backfeed. Data shows synchronized controls decrease fuel use from 40% to 60% during outages. We'll size batteries correctly, determine charge priorities, and program backup modes so your generator activates solely when solar and storage fall short of demand.

    What Roof Types Are Unsuitable for Solar in Chilliwack?

    Similar to shoes on ice, certain roofs lack proper solar grip. In Chilliwack, you should steer clear of thatch roofs (fire risk, no anchoring) and aging flat membranes without adequate ballast systems (leak risk, wind uplift). Steep cedar shakes and brittle slate also underperform due to brittleness and mounting restrictions. Heavy snow loads and high winds amplify risks. Opt for engineered mounting on metal standing seam or modern asphalt; structural assessment and membrane upgrades solve most constraints.

    How Do Snow and Moss Impact Panel Performance Here?

    Both snow and moss decrease production. Snow buildup can cut production by 80–100% until it slides; a 30–40° slope, dark frames, and smooth glass facilitate shedding. Yield decreases 5–15% from moss shading due to blocked sunlight and hotspot development. You'll mitigate it with anti-reflective, hydrophobic coatings, proper array spacing, and wiring strings to minimize mismatch. Use bypass diodes, monitor string-level data, trim overhanging branches, and schedule gentle, annual cleanings with approved biocide.
